Requirements

As a Clerical Assistant 3, you will provide comprehensive clerical and administrative support to the Building Division, including receiving, logging, and processing building plan submissions through mail, online systems, and in-person drop-offs.

You will be responsible for maintaining organized records and tracking systems, preparing reports, and ensuring accurate distribution of incoming and outgoing correspondence.

Work involves serving as the primary point of contact for customers by phone and email, assisting with incomplete submissions, general inquiries, forms, and fees.

You will also have the opportunity to provide guidance to staff, supporting special projects and mailings, ensuring efficient daily operations through strong organization, communication, and problem-solving skills.

Additional responsibilities include:

  • Assisting with scanning, data entry, compliance reporting, and database maintenance related to regulatory programs
  • Maintaining working knowledge of applicable codes and procedures
  • Completing detailed file research and records management across multiple systems
  • Fulfilling public information requests
  • Handling financial processing tasks

Qualifications

QUALIFICATIONS

Minimum Experience and Training Requirements:

  • One year as a Clerical Assistant 2 (Commonwealth job title or equivalent Federal Government job title, as determined by the Office of Administration); or
  • One year of moderately complex clerical experience; or
  • An equivalent combination of experience and training.


Other Requirements:

  • You must meet the PA residency requirement. For more information on ways to meet PA residency requirements, follow the link and click on Residency.
  • You must be able to perform essential job functions.
